The marketing materials that you create for your business -- be they blog posts, podcasts or videos -- are vital to attracting and engaging customers.

On this episode of #theREI360show, Chris Haddon and Jason Balin, co-founders of Columbia, M.D.-based lending and real estate companies Hard Money Bankers and REI 360, discuss four laws of creating and distributing content. From providing value to your audience to being consistent, content marketing requires strategy. At the same time, however, content marketing is most effective when you "be yourself," the co-founders explain.
